The aim of the research was to determine optimal technological approaches for grain sorghum cultivation through the selection of promising hybrids, effective micronutrient fertilizers, and growth regulators, as well as to assess their effects on plant growth and development, productivity, and economic and energy efficiency. It was established that the duration of the growing season corresponded to the varietal characteristics of the hybrids and amounted to 104–107 days for the Brigga hybrid and 114–115 days for the Yutami hybrid. The studied technological elements significantly influenced the course of interstage periods, crop density and plant survival, leaf area formation, photosynthetic potential, and net photosynthetic productivity. The highest levels of stand density preservation (94.0–94.6%) were achieved through the combination of foliar fertilization with Alpha-Grow-Extra or Intermag–Corn micronutrient fertilizers and the application of the growth regulators Regoplant or Stimpo. The study revealed that optimal combinations of micronutrient fertilizers and growth regulators promoted more intensive dry matter accumulation, increased seed weight, and improved yield formation. At the same time, the hybrids differed in their productivity strategies: Brigga formed a smaller number of grains with higher individual grain weight, whereas Yutami produced a greater number of grains per plant. The highest profitability and energy efficiency indicators were obtained under foliar application of the micronutrient fertilizer Alpha-Grow-Extra in combination with the growth regulator Stimpo, which ensured high energy output from the yield and a high energy efficiency coefficient.
